Monitoring on Insecticide Resistance of the Brown Planthopper and the White Backed Planthopper in Asia

Journal of Asia-Pacific Entomology, 2002
Abstract Annual change in insecticide susceptibility of the long-range migrating rice insects, the brown planthopper (BPH) and the white backed planthopper (WBPH), monitored by topical application was reviewed covering temperate and tropical Asia. Monitoring in Japan revealed consistent increase in topical LD50 of BPH for various insecticides during ...
